UTAir Flight Overruns Runway in Sochi, Russia; 18 Injured

UTAir flight UT-579 overran the end of the runway on landing in Sochi, Russia, on September 1st.

The incident happened when the Boeing 737-800 plane was coming from Moscow, Russia.

The plane came to stop in a river bed off the runway and its left engine caught fire.

There were one hundred and seventy people aboard at the time; eighteen of them were injured.

An airport worker died after having a heart attack at the scene of the incident.

Russian Military Plane Crashed Into Black Sea, Killing 92 Aboard

A Russian military plane crashed into the black sea near Sochi, Russia, on the morning of December 25th.

The Tupolev Tu-154 plane had just taken off from the Adler airport, Sochi, when it suddenly disappeared from radar. The plane was en-route to the Hmeymim airbase in Latakia, Syria, for a New Year’s Eve concert.

All 92 passengers were killed in the crash.

The accident is being investigated.
